A Certificate Programme in Electric Vehicle Range Strategies is increasingly significant in the UK's rapidly evolving automotive landscape. The UK government aims for all new car sales to be zero-emission by 2030, driving massive growth in the EV sector. This necessitates expertise in optimizing EV range, a key factor influencing consumer adoption. According to the Society of Motor Manufacturers and Traders (SMMT), battery electric vehicle (BEV) registrations in the UK increased by 40% in 2022, highlighting the burgeoning market. Understanding range anxiety, battery technology, charging infrastructure, and energy management is crucial for professionals in this field.
